Little girl dead, her sister injured after dresser falls on them

ALIQUIPPA, Pa. — One little girl was killed and a second little girl was injured in a tragic accident Friday morning in Beaver County.

Police in Aliquippa told Channel 11's Amy Marcinkiewicz that 2-year-old Brooklyn Beatty and her 3-year-old sister Ryeley were playing in a bedroom when a dresser fell on top of them.

The incident occurred inside their home on Irwin Street at approximately 11 a.m. Friday.

Rebecca Beatty, the girls' aunt, lives in the house next door. She ran to help shortly after the accident.

"I heard the father screaming, yelling" She said. "I rushed over, and because I'm a nurse, started CPR."

Brooklyn was pronounced dead that afternoon. As of late Friday evening, Ryeley was still hospitalized in critical condition.
